Subreddit Rules
  1. Editorialized or sensationalized headline / Titres éditorialisés ou sensationnalistes: - Whenever possible, use the exact headline of the article as it appears at the source. - Do not alter the original article headline to selectively present or misrepresent information. - Do not use link redirectors or archiving services - use direct links - Do not use self-posts to post links - Version française: https://www.reddit.com/r/canada/wiki/regles
  2. TL;DR: Don't change the headline, and don't interject your own opinion.**
  3. Antagonistic to another person / Hostilité envers autrui: - Flamebait (inflammatory meta submissions and comments) will be removed. - Posts which dismiss others and repeatedly accuse them of unfounded accusations may be subject to removal and/or banning. - We reserve the right to remove any religiously intolerant, racist, sexist or otherwise antagonistic posts. - Posts that attack others will be removed. - Version française: https://www.reddit.com/r/canada/wiki/regles
  4. TL;DR: You stay classy, /r/Canada. Don't cause trouble, don't be rude.**
  5. No negative generalizations, bigotry, prejudice, hatred / Pas de généralisations négatives, préjugés: - Negative generalizations, especially on the grounds of race / sex / gender / gender identity / sexual orientation / religion / language / national origin are prohibited. - Les généralisations négatives, en particulier pour des motifs de race / sexe / genre / identité de genre / orientation sexuelle / religion / langue / origine nationale sont interdites.
  6. Post doesn't relate to Canada / Contenu sans lien avec le Canada: - Posts which do not relate to Canada will be removed. / Les postes qui ne concernent pas le Canada seront supprimés. - Posts which relate to Canada only in passing will also likely be removed. / Le contenu qui ne concerne que vaguement le Canada sera probablement supprimé. - Local news may be removed / Les nouvelles locales peuvent être supprimées
  7. Low content / Contenu à faible teneur: - Low content submissions and posts will be removed. - Twitter, Youtube, CBC First Person, social media, press releases, Substack blogs / fringe media submissions and posts will be removed. - Off-topic comments (derailing) will likely be removed. - Posts or comments that do nothing but attack the source of a submission will be removed. - Memes using standard images, or standard "Canadian stereotype" posts will be removed. - Version française: https://www.reddit.com/r/canada/wiki/regles
  8. Trolling: disrupting normal, on-topic discussion / perturber le cours normal d’une discussion: - Trolling is defined as sowing discord by starting arguments, posting inflammatory, extraneous, or off-topic messages, often with the intent of disrupting normal, on-topic discussion. Trolling will not be tolerated. Posts will be removed, and repeat offenders will be given a temporary ban. Continued trolling will result in a permanent ban. - Accounts flagged by Reddit for Ban Evasion will be removed and banned. - Version française: https://www.reddit.com/r/canada/wiki/regles
  9. Duplicate or similar post already exists / Doublons ou contenu similaire: - Posts which are similar in content to existing posts will likely be removed, especially if they don't add much to the discussion. - Le contenu similaire aux publications existantes sera probablement supprimé, surtout s'il n'ajoute pas grand chose à la discussion.
  10. Flooding r/Canada with articles / Limite de soumission: - Please limit yourself to 3 posts per day. When users flood r/Canada with articles they prevent others from participating and often push an agenda. We ask that our users limit themselves to 3 posts per day. - Veuillez vous limiter à 3 postes par jour. Lorsque les utilisateurs inondent le r/Canada d'articles, ils empêchent les autres de participer et poussent souvent un agenda. Nous demandons à nos utilisateurs de se limiter à 3 messages par jour.
  11. No misinformation spreading:
  12. Advocating violence and illegal activity : Posts or comments that advocate or endorse violence or illegal activity are subject to removal and bans.
  13. Ban Evasion: Accounts flagged by Reddit for ban evasion are banned. If you feel your account was flagged in error, please reach out to Reddit Admins.
